Headquartered in a historic church, the Maude Kerns Art Center in Eugene was founded in 1950. The chief benefactress was Maude Kerns, a local artist who has a piece in the Guggenheim Museum. The center offers classes and workshops for kids and adults, as well as a pottery studio and a gallery.
